Heavy rains disrupt power supply to 148 PESCO feeders

Heavy rainfall across the Peshawar Electric Supply Company (PESCO) region has caused significant disruptions to power supply, affecting 148 feeders and multiple districts. A spokesperson for PESCO confirmed this on Tuesday.

The affected areas include several regions within the broader PESCO jurisdiction, impacting a wide range of consumers who rely on these feeders for electricity. The disruption is expected to continue until weather conditions improve.

PESCO has been monitoring the situation closely and is working towards restoring power as quickly as possible. However, given the severity of the rainfall, full restoration may take some time.

Consumers in the affected areas are advised to remain vigilant and follow safety guidelines during this period. PESCO encourages residents to report any issues or concerns directly through their customer service channels.

The spokesperson stated that 'the priority is ensuring public safety and restoring power as soon as possible.'

This incident highlights the challenges faced by utility companies in managing power supply during extreme weather conditions. PESCO has been under increased pressure to maintain reliable services, especially in regions prone to heavy rainfall.
